Which Styles of Sofa Chairs Stand Out in Modern Living Rooms?

In contemporary interiors, certain styles of sofa chairs capture attention and elevate the ambiance of modern living rooms. One standout option is the mid-century modern chair, characterized by its sleek lines and organic shapes, offering both comfort and elegance. These pieces often feature tapered legs and vibrant upholstery, making them a perfect addition to minimalist settings.

Another notable style is the industrial chic chair, which combines raw materials like metal and distressed leather. This design not only provides a rugged aesthetic but also complements urban lofts and spaces with an edgy vibe. The juxtaposition of soft cushions against hard surfaces creates a visually appealing contrast.

Finally, the Scandinavian style chair stands out for its functionality and simplicity. With clean lines and neutral colors, these chairs promote a serene atmosphere while ensuring practicality in everyday living. Together, these styles contribute to the evolving narrative of modern living room design.

What are the characteristics of Mid-Century Modern sofa chairs?

Mid-Century Modern sofa chairs are celebrated for their distinctive design aesthetics, which blend functionality with artistic flair. Characterized by clean lines and organic shapes, these chairs often feature geometric forms that lend a sense of structure without overwhelming the space. The use of natural materials, such as wood and leather, reflects a commitment to craftsmanship and sustainability, making them both visually appealing and durable.

Another hallmark of Mid-Century Modern sofa chairs is the emphasis on comfort and user experience. The ergonomic designs encourage relaxation, often incorporating plush cushions that invite lounging. These chairs often come in a variety of vibrant colors and patterns, allowing for personalization and adaptation to various interior styles.

Finally, the versatility of Mid-Century Modern sofa chairs makes them a staple in contemporary design. Whether placed in a minimalist living room or a more eclectic setting, they effortlessly enhance the ambiance while maintaining their timeless appeal.

How can you balance a statement chair with other furniture?

When incorporating a statement chair into a living space, achieving balance with other furniture is essential for a cohesive look. First, consider the color scheme of the room. The chair can either complement or contrast with surrounding pieces, but must harmonize with the overall palette to avoid visual chaos.

Next, think about scale and proportion. A large, bold chair can dominate a small room, so pairing it with equally substantial furniture, such as a robust coffee table or shelving unit, can create equilibrium. Alternatively, surrounding the chair with lighter, more delicate pieces can provide a sense of airiness.

Finally, the style of the other furniture should be considered. Mixing styles can add interest, but a common theme or motif can help tie the space together. By thoughtfully selecting surrounding items, the statement chair can truly shine while contributing to a well-rounded aesthetic.

What Are the Best Color and Fabric Options for Statement Sofa Chairs?

When it comes to selecting the best color and fabric options for statement sofa chairs, it’s essential to consider both aesthetics and functionality. Vibrant hues like emerald green, mustard yellow, or royal blue can make a bold impact, drawing the eye and serving as a focal point in any room. Alternatively, more muted tones like blush pink or charcoal gray can also be effective, providing a sophisticated contrast without overwhelming the space.

In terms of fabric, options such as velvet add a luxurious feel, enhancing the chair’s visual appeal while offering comfort. On the other hand, leather provides durability and a classic look, ideal for high-traffic areas. For a more eclectic style, consider combining different fabrics and colors, which can create a unique, personalized touch that reflects the homeowner’s individual taste.
